9 Beaches Ordered Closed 'Until Further Notice' In Wake Of Powerful Storm System, Torrential Rains
Swimmers are advised to avoid the water today due to bacterial contamination from road runoff into drainage outfalls near the beaches.

WESTCHESTER COUNTY, NY — The Sound Shore avoided the worst of the flooding, but the effects of a powerful storm system that hit the Hudson Valley are still being felt at the seaside.
Health officials have closed a handful of Long Island Sound beaches after severe storms and torrential rains moved through the region.
The Westchester County Health Department has closed the beaches preemptively for Tuesday because of 3.38 inches of rainfall over the past 24 hours.

In New Rochelle, Hudson Park Beach, Davenport Beach Club, Greentree Country Club and the Surf Club on the Sound are closed.
In Mamaroneck, Harbor Island Park, Beach Point Club, Orienta Beach Club and the Mamaroneck Beach and Yacht Club have been closed to swimmers.

In Rye, the Coveleigh Club has been ordered to close.
Beach patrons are advised to avoid the water today due to bacterial contamination from road runoff into drainage outfalls near these beaches. The beaches will remain closed until further notice, according to health officials.
